About this property

    ** cranbrook school catchment area! **

    This beautifully presented detached family home from the 1930s is ideally situated within walking distance of Hawkhurst village. The property offers four bedrooms, two reception rooms, a garage, off-road parking, and front and rear gardens.

    Upon entering, you are welcomed into a light, spacious entrance hall featuring high ceilings and inviting decor. To your right is the generous living room, which benefits from a west-facing bay window that floods the space with natural light, complemented by an open fireplace that adds warmth and character. Adjacent to this is a separate dining room with patio doors opening to the rear garden, creating a seamless indoor-outdoor living experience. The kitchen is fitted with wall and base units, partial integrated appliances, and space for a washing machine, dishwasher, and freestanding fridge/freezer, all offering pleasant views over the walled rear garden. A W.C completes the ground floor.

    Upstairs, the property boasts four bedrooms. The main bedroom features a large bay window and a charming decorative fireplace. The family bathroom is accompanied by a separate W.C next door.

    Externally, the home is set back from the road with off-road parking for several vehicles, a single garage, and a neatly maintained lawn bordered by mature fruit trees. To the rear is a pretty walled garden and benefits from two inviting seating areas perfect for relaxation and outdoor entertaining.

    The current owners have upgraded the wiring, plumbing, and plasterwork, with further scope for modernisation and personalisation, allowing new owners to tailor the home to their preferences. Its highly desirable location also makes it an excellent opportunity for rental or investment purposes.

    The village offers a variety of local amenities, including two supermarkets (Tesco and Waistrose), a doctor's surgery, a dentist, a hairdresser, a library, a post office and a chemist. Residents can also enjoy a Kino cinema, a butcher, a bakery, a café, and numerous independent shops. The area features two popular pubs, The Queens Inn and the Royal Oak. Families will find schools catering to all ages, with the property located within the Cranbrook School catchment area. Additionally, regular train services to central London are available from nearby Staplehurst and Etchingham stations.
